Broken seals

A break in the seal of your double-glazed windows can cause condensation and misting. This allows moisture in the insulation portion of the window, which causes the windows' efficiency to reduce and warm air to escape into the home. There are a few simple steps you can follow to fix these problems.

The most important step is to determine whether the condensation or misting is on the outside or inside the window. If the condensation is outside it is an unnatural phenomenon caused by changes in weather conditions. It's not a problem with your double glazing. If the condensation is on the inside it could be an indication of a broken seal and the need to replace the double glazing.

If your windows remain under warranty then the installers will rectify this at no cost to you based on the terms of your guarantee. You can also hire an experienced window replacement service to replace your windows for a reasonable price. This is a great way of replacing your windows with energy-efficient ones without having to replace your frames and walls.

One of the best ways to prevent a double-glazing seal breaking is by keeping the frame in good condition. Every two years, the exterior seam should be caulked, and the wood should receive an afresh coat of paint. Avoid using high-pressure washers on your windows as this could damage the insulated glass unit.

Another preventative measure is to put a reflective window film the window. This can reduce the loss of heat, which can make the insulating glass work more efficiently. It's important to consult the manufacturer prior to adding reflective window film, as certain manufacturers claim that it will void the warranty. Finally, you should also avoid rubbing or touching your windows since this could result in scratches and permanent marks on the glass surface. These scratches and marks can then allow moisture into the glass unit, which can cause the seal to break down. Energy efficiency

Double glazing is an excellent investment for any home, offering more warmth and blocking out the noise of the outside, but it can be an even better one in terms of energy efficiency. This is because the gas layer between the two panes of glass acts as insulation, keeping cold air out and the warm air inside, thus reducing your heating bills.

But if your double glazing is prone to condensation between the windows, it will no longer be performing this role and you could notice a slight increase in your energy bills. Windows that have been damaged by condensation can be repaired. In some cases, that is all it requires.

Most commonly, misted windows are caused by a failed seal between two panes. This allows moisture enter. This is typically the result of older windows that have degraded over time, but it can be caused by the installation of a window that is not properly done or a brand new window that has been damaged through accident.

This damage means the window won't be sealed and it won't be able to keep cold air out and let the warm air in, which means that you're losing energy and money. There are a few ways to stop this from happening, for instance opening your windows for a few minutes each day to let the air circulate and making use of dehumidifiers throughout your home.
